Since opening in 2000 in a vintage 1920s drugstore on Main Street, The Continental Club Houston has become the city’s home for real-deal rock n roll, roots, soul, and touring legends. Think U2, Ian McLagan, Nick Lowe, Barbara Lynn, and local heroes like Roy Head and Archie Bell—all have hit the stage. Today, it’s where to go for killer live music any night of the week.
